What feature suggests the presence of a supermassive black hole or dense stellar remnants in the core of massive ellipticals like M87?

Answer

Steeply rising stellar velocities toward the center.

Observations showing stellar velocities rising sharply toward the galactic center in massive ellipticals strongly indicate the gravitational influence of a supermassive black hole or a dense concentration of stellar remnants.
